Output ed65ed5a1c7877c0b3ea4f8837f0712be114bf17c3f57e9205143c0e2c06c9d1:0

value
24087
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b201f725517cc4d3ba277e9a83a7579a8cb5c06 OP_EQUAL
address
39zqtw96SdCLriUDnr5XHe3k7NEzh89gnE
transaction
ed65ed5a1c7877c0b3ea4f8837f0712be114bf17c3f57e9205143c0e2c06c9d1
confirmations
315842
spent
true